em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: improving query-replace and query-replace-regexp


From: Miles Bader
Subject: Re: improving query-replace and query-replace-regexp
Date: Sat, 29 May 2004 17:31:32 -0400
User-agent: Mutt/1.3.28i

On Sun, May 30, 2004 at 12:15:00AM +0300, Juri Linkov wrote:
> But an empty argument to M-% can't be used to repeat query-replace
> because the first argument of query-replace makes sense even when
> it is empty.  It can be used to insert a replacement string between
> all characters, i.e. to change a string like "abcdef" into ";a;b;c;d;e;f;"
> by (query-replace "" ";").  This is an infrequent operation but
> still makes sense.

I don't think it's frequent enough to matter; the "empty string inserts
between characters" usage is a kludgey hack, not something you expect people
to know about.

> There should be a better solution like already proposed M-% M-% with
> the second M-% typed in the minibuffer.

That's a really kludgey hack too.  Minibuffer input is _not like_ isearch
input...

-Miles
-- 
Saa, shall we dance?  (from a dance-class advertisement)




reply via email to

[Prev in Thread] Current Thread [Next in Thread]